Job Description: Ryan Companies is searching for a Senior Investment Analyst in our Chicago office! This role will provide analytical support for Ryan-owned and developed projects across the Ryan Investment Group which includes the Capital Markets, Asset Management, and Portfolio Management teams. The position also supports the SVPs, VPs and Directors in managing Ryan Investment Group’s needs for assets from inception to final disposition. To be successful, the candidate must demonstrate mastery of commercial real estate investment concepts through analysis and communication with internal and external stakeholders and have the ability to consider strategic objectives with a focus on increasing the value of the Ryan’s assets. Some things you can expect to do: Support SVPs, VPs and Directors on the capitalization of identified development projects with JV equity and construction loans including underwriting, preparation of offering packages, and selective interaction with capital providers. Underwrite development for industrial, multifamily, data centers, office, retail, and healthcare properties across the U.S. Gather and analyze relevant market data and help interpret trends. Collaborate with marketing team to produce best-in-class materials. Maintain project database with information available for immediate access related to key indicators, performance and project details. Support conducting hold/sell/refinance evaluations Provide guidance to capital markets analysts. Provide support to manage broker interactions and relationships. Support sale process of Ryan investment properties. Assist in preparing and executing business plans, including budgeting and reforecasting. Knowledge of key CRE asset types: office, industrial, retail, and multifamily. Some overnight travel expected. To be successful in this role you will need: Bachelor's degree in in finance, real estate, or business or a related filed is required. One year or more of financial analysis experience related to commercial real estate transactions, including a strong understanding of strengths and challenges of real estate projects. Strong quantitative and qualitative skills in regards to presenting data and financial information. Ability to work both independently and on a team. Ability to develop strong relationships. Excellent written and verbal communication skills and overall attention to detail. Familiarity with Argus is strongly preferred. Proficiency with Excel and ability to create and edit sophisticated models Ability to work with ambiguity and with a strong attention to detail.
